A Simple, Heartfelt Wish
An 11‑year‑old boy undergoing treatment for a brain tumor had one modest request: a phone call from his baseball hero, Nolan Arenado. The boy’s family shared the wish with friends, hoping the message might reach the star.
A Hero Happens
Rather than merely dial in, Nolan Arenado took extraordinary action. He arranged a flight to the boy’s hospital and surprised everyone by arriving in person at the bedside. Reports describe how the young patient’s wish went from a simple voicemail to a real-life visit from his hero.
